16/11/2008Launch of PULSE recording studio in yipworld.com, Cumnock


yipworld.com is very proud to launch the opening of the PULSE recording studio funded by the BIG Lottery Fund and the Cumnock and Doon Valley Minerals Trust. Over 120 people attended the high profile event on Monday 10th November in yipworld.com premises where the studio is based. Adam Ingram MSP officially opened the high tech facility, which has Protools HD system running on a control 24 mixing desk.

Musical talent was in abundance with the Ayrshire Indie Band 'The Ghosties' providing a melodic masterpiece; Steven McIntyre aka Tragic O'Hara on acoustic guitar and closing performance by young talented Ayrshire vocalist Rebecca Shearing. The Youth Music Forum, consisting of members of yipworld.com was introduced to the audience and were given credit for their excellent commitment to the colour scheme; the logo and the name PULSE.

Mediaspec - The UK Pro Audio specialists based in East Kilbride provided the design and layout of the Studio. Special thanks went to David Scherchen for his outstanding work that resulted in the studio being opened well ahead of schedule.

Provost Stephanie Young; Elected Members; Chief Executive Fiona Lees; Jim Sweeney, Chief Executive of Youthlink Scotland; partner organisations; yipworld.com Board of Directors, Ayr College, staff from local schools, friends and family of yipworld.com were among the many guests on the evening.

The studio is now open for business and already a number of bookings have been received. There are two elements to the service, one is educational where schools in the coalfields communities can access the studio for their pupils free gratis, with concessionary rates to schools based outwith this geographic location. The second element is commercial business where the proceeds and income generation will contribute to the sustainability of the studio and social enterprise business yipworld.com.
